Disclaimer: This insight is meant purely as a conceptual clarification for students so that such nuances do not cause confusion during preparation. In this discussion, I want to highlight an interesting conceptual point regarding a question on vectors lying in the same plane from the 24th January, 2nd shift paper of JEE Mains 2026. As we know, for three vectors to lie in the same plane, their scalar triple product must be zero. This can also be expressed as v = ax + by, where a, b, and v are coplanar vectors and x, y are real numbers. In the paper, the question used the form v = a + k b (with k being real). While this is a special case, it limits the possible vectors to a line within the plane, whereas the complete set of coplanar vectors is infinite. In reality, the correct condition ensures that |v| ≥ √11 / 2, which means all the given options satisfy the condition. Remember, conceptual gaps can cost marks in competitive exams, and clarity is the key to confidence.
